With decades of experience in **industrial cooling, enclosure protection, and power management**, nVent provides solutions that **enhance equipment lifespan, reduce operational costs, and ensure compliance with safety standards**. **Installation & Compatibility Considerations:** - **Mounting Flexibility:** The **side-mount design** allows for **vertical or horizontal installation**, accommodating various enclosure configurations. Ensure proper **ventilation clearance** (typically 4–6 inches) around the unit for optimal airflow. - **Power Requirements:** Verify that the **230V AC power supply** matches the unit’s specifications. For installations in regions with **voltage fluctuations**, consider adding a **surge protector or voltage regulator** to prevent damage. - **Thermal Load Calculation:** Select the **2500/2700 BTU model** based on the **heat load of your enclosure**. Consult nVent’s **thermal management guides** or use their **online sizing tools** to determine the correct capacity for your application. - **Maintenance Best Practices:** Schedule **regular inspections** to clean filters, check refrigerant levels, and inspect electrical connections. Frequently Asked Questions about nVent

What industries and applications are nVent products used for?

nVent products are engineered for critical infrastructure and industrial applications across multiple demanding sectors. Key markets include Construction, Data Centers, Defense, Healthcare, Mining, Oil & Gas Refineries, Power Plants, Rail/Transit, Renewable Energy, Security, Ship Building, Steel Mills, Telecom, and Utilities. Their solutions are designed to withstand extreme environmental conditions, with temperature ranges from -55°C to 105°C and specialized features like UV resistance, oil resistance, and flame resistance.

What environmental ratings do nVent products have?

nVent enclosures feature comprehensive environmental ratings, including UL 508A, CSA, and NEMA Type 1, 2, 3, 4, 4X, 12, and 13 certifications. They are rated IEC 60529 IP66, providing robust protection against dust, water, and corrosion in both indoor and outdoor environments. These products operate effectively in temperatures ranging from -40°F to 266°F, with enhanced UV inhibitors for outdoor weathering and oil-resistant gaskets for superior sealing.

What is nVent's warranty policy?

nVent offers a standard 18-month warranty from invoicing date for most automation products, covering defects in workmanship and materials. The warranty requires proper transportation, handling, storage, and installation within specified environmental conditions. Warranty coverage includes repair or replacement at nVent's discretion, with certain conditions such as authorized service repairs and operation within designed capacity limits.
